Product Information
Extended Description
X37 SA Eaton Crouse-Hinds: Eaton Crouse-Hinds series Condulet Form 7 conduit outlet body, Copper-free aluminum, X shape, 1"
Product Name
Eaton Crouse-Hinds series Condulet Form 7 conduit outlet body
Catalog Number
X37 SA
UPC
782274746111
Product Length/Depth
7.25 in
Product Height
4 in
Product Width
2.25 in
Product Weight
1.1 lb
Area classification
Ordinary/Non-Hazardous Locations
Standards type
NEC/CEC
NEMA Rating
12
Shape
X
Trade size
1"
Material
Copper-free aluminum

FAQs
The X37 SA is a Form 7 conduit outlet body designed for 1 inch trade size installations. Its copper-free aluminum construction and X-shaped body ensure a compact footprint, making it suitable for panel enclosures where space is limited. The format supports standard conduit routing while maintaining ease of wire pulling and alignment with Form 7 mounting patterns, reducing rework during panel wiring.
X37 SA carries NEC/CEC compliance and a NEMA 12 rating, validating it for ordinary/non-hazardous locations and providing protection against dust and dripping non-corrosive liquids. This ensures safer installations in standard industrial environments and streamlines compliance testing for electrical panels and enclosures used in manufacturing, process, and packaging settings.
Yes, the X37 SA is intended for Ordinary/Non-Hazardous Locations per its area classification. It is not designed for hazardous environments, where explosion or severe dust/water ingress could exceed its protection rating. For non-hazardous panel applications, this Form 7 body provides reliable protection and straightforward wiring when installed according to NEC/CEC guidelines.
